Is Castle Cove Duplex Safe?
Yes — this neighborhood is extremely safe. Castle Cove Duplex in Garland, TX has a safety grade of A+. The overall crime index is 16, which is 84% below the national average of 100.
Compared to the Garland average (crime index 50), Castle Cove Duplex is 34% lower in overall crime. This neighborhood is significantly safer than Garland as a whole, making it an attractive option for safety-conscious residents.
Looking at specific crime types, rape is the most elevated concern (index: 104, 4% above average), while assault is the lowest risk (index: 11).
